This is a cabinet card taken in 1898 of a corner in Mrs. Gray’s dining room. There is a large shelf with lots of dishes, baskets, and books, including one entitled “Europe Illustrated.” Propped up against the wall are three tennis rackets and on the left is a large framed screen with an oriental bird design. In the right side of the image you can see young woman seated under a lamp reading a book. The picture was taken in Oswego, but I don’t know what state. No photographer identified. Overall size: 6” x 5 ¼”. A bit of light soiling and image is slightly faded, however details can still be clearly seen. No bends. THE FINE PRINT: Buyer pays $2.20 for shipping/handling.
